Tert-butyl 7-oxo-5-oxa-2,8-diazaspiro[3.5]nonane-2-carboxylate is a complex organic compound characterized by its unique molecular structure. It is a derivative of spiro[3.5]nonane, featuring a carboxylate group and an oxa ring, which contribute to its reactivity and potential applications in various chemical processes.

1363381-20-7 Usage

Uses

Used in Pharmaceutical Industry:
Tert-butyl 7-oxo-5-oxa-2,8-diazaspiro[3.5]nonane-2-carboxylate is used as a reactant for the efficient preparation of a diverse array of amino alcohol chiral fragments. These chiral fragments are essential building blocks in the synthesis of various pharmaceutical compounds, particularly those with chiral centers that are crucial for their biological activity and selectivity.
Used in Chemical Synthesis:
In the field of chemical synthesis, tert-butyl 7-oxo-5-oxa-2,8-diazaspiro[3.5]nonane-2-carboxylate serves as a versatile intermediate for the creation of complex organic molecules. Its unique structure allows for multiple points of reactivity, making it a valuable component in the synthesis of a wide range of compounds with potential applications in various industries, including p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als, and materials science.
Used in Research and Development:
Due to its structural complexity and reactivity, tert-butyl 7-oxo-5-oxa-2,8-diazaspiro[3.5]nonane-2-carboxylate is also utilized in research and development settings. It can be employed as a test compound to study various reaction mechanisms, explore new synthetic routes, and develop innovative methodologies in organic chemistry. This contributes to the advancement of scientific knowledge and the discovery of new chemical processes and applications.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 1363381-20-7 includes 10 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 7 digits, 1,3,6,3,3,8 and 1 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 2 and 0 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1363381-20:
(9*1)+(8*3)+(7*6)+(6*3)+(5*3)+(4*8)+(3*1)+(2*2)+(1*0)=147
147 % 10 = 7
So 1363381-20-7 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Efficient Routes to a Diverse Array of Amino Alcohol-Derived Chiral Fragments

Haftchenary, Sina,Nelson, Shawn D.,Furst, Laura,Dandapani, Sivaraman,Ferrara, Steven J.,Bo?kovi?, ?arko V.,Figueroa Lazú, Samuel,Guerrero, Adrian M.,Serrano, Juan C.,Crews, Demarcus K.,Brackeen, Cristina,Mowat, Jeffrey,Brumby, Thomas,Bauser, Marcus,Schreiber, Stuart L.,Phillips, Andrew J.

supporting information, p. 569 - 574 (2016/10/06)

Efficient syntheses of chiral fragments derived from chiral amino alcohols are described. Several unique scaffolds were readily accessed in 1-5 synthetic steps leading to 45 chiral fragments, including oxazolidinones, morpholinones, lactams, and sultams. These fragments have molecular weights ranging from 100 to 255 Da and are soluble in water (0.085 to >15 mM).
